Transaction 81b2478d740f7604e13783999c923311378c5ef060dcb15342d6ae77afdfc225
1 Input
1 Output
-
81b2478d740f7604e13783999c923311378c5ef060dcb15342d6ae77afdfc225:0
- value
- 492129
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 a0ba059816c249c1a3bbbc970219b530b15bc57df4a164c970b8c5778c563c39
- address
- bc1p5zaqtxqkcfyurgamhjtsyxd4xzc4h3ta7jskfjtshrzh0rzk8susux4xcm